A 71-year-old woman woke up Friday morning to the sound of a car crashing through the front of her DeKalb County home.

“It was so devastating, the sound. Like the house was tumbling in,” Carolyn Burgess told AJC.com. “I couldn’t look out the window right away. All I could do was get myself together.”

DeKalb police said the Ford SUV was stolen shortly before the driver crashed into Burgess’ home on Browns Mill Ferry Road near Lithonia about 8 a.m., taking out the corner of her garage and her front porch.

“As he was trying to escape, the car came into my yard, driveway and knocked down the garage, and as you can see it’s collapsed,” Burgess said.

The driver hopped out and ran off before police got there.

Burgess said that even after officers and EMS arrived to help her out of her damaged home, she was wary of leaving her bedroom on the second floor.

“I was afraid to come downstairs because I didn’t know if someone was in my house,” she said. “I’m still feeling sick inside.”

The incident is under investigation.
